An Act
To authorize the Secretary of Commerce to make available to the
University of Miami property under the administrative jurisdiction of
the National Oceanic and Atmospheric Administration on Virginia Key,
Florida, for use by the University for a Marine Life Science Center.
Be it enacted by the Senate and House of Representatives of the
United States of America in Congress assembled,
SECTION 1. AVAILABILITY OF NOAA REAL PROPERTY ON VIRGINIA KEY, FLORIDA.
(a) In General.--The Secretary of Commerce may make available to
the University of Miami real property under the administrative
jurisdiction of the National Oceanic and Atmospheric Administration on
Virginia Key, Florida, for development by the University of a Marine
Life Science Center.
(b) Manner of Availability.--The Secretary may make property
available under this section by easement, lease, license, or long-term
agreement with the University.
(c) Authorized Uses by University.--
(1) In general.--Property made available under this section may
be used by the University (subject to paragraph (2)) to develop and
operate facilities for multidisciplinary environmental and
fisheries research, assessment, management, and educational
activities.
(2) Agreement.--Property made available under this section may
not be used by the University (including any affiliate of the
University) except in accordance with an agreement with the
Secretary that--
(A) specifies--
(i) the conditions for non-Federal use of the property;
and
(ii) the retained Federal interests in the property,
including interests in access to and egress from the
property by Federal personnel and preservation of existing
rights-of-way;
(B) establishes conditions for joint occupancy of buildings
and other facilities on the property by the University and
Federal agencies; and
(C) includes provisions that ensure--
(i) that there is no diminishment of existing National
Oceanic and Atmospheric Administration programs and
services at Virginia Key; and
(ii) the availability of the property for planning,
development, and construction of future Federal buildings
and facilities.
(3) Termination of availability.--The availability of property
under this section shall terminate immediately upon use of the
property by the University--
(A) for any purpose other than as described in paragraph
(1); or
(B) in violation of the agreement under paragraph (2).
(d) Use of Facilities by Secretary.--The Secretary may--
(1) subject to the availability of funding, enter into an
agreement to occupy facilities constructed by the University on
property made available under this section; and
(2) participate with the University in collaborative research
at, or administered through, such facilities.
(e) No Conveyance of Title.--This section shall not be construed to
convey or authorize conveyance of any interest of the United States in
title to property made available under this section.
